  • Abstract
    This article presents an approach to integrate supervision information directly into process control strategies. It focuses on one of the basic tasks of plant and process supervision: the validation of process information. A framework is suggested for how sophisticated process control functions with the knowledge of additional supervision information can react to abnormal process situations in order to keep the process running and stable. These tasks can be realised using function blocks, an established software approach for distributed control systems applicable to workstations as well as to microprocessors in remote I/O.
